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

Arona

Costs and Efficiency:

When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.

SEAT Arona is substantially cheaper – starting at 20,700 £ , while the SERES 5 costs 55,700 £ . That’s a price difference of around 35,005 £.

5

Engine and Performance:

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.

When it comes to engine power, the SERES 5 offers substantially more power – delivering 585 HP compared to 150 HP. That’s roughly 435 HP more horsepower.

When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the SERES 5 is considerably quicker – completing the sprint in 4.1 s, while the SEAT Arona takes 8.3 s. That’s about 4.2 s quicker.

There’s also a difference in torque: the SERES 5 delivers considerably more torque with 940 Nm compared to 250 Nm. That’s about 690 Nm more.

Arona

Space and Everyday Use:

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?

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.

In terms of curb weight, SEAT Arona is significantly lighter – 1,188 kg compared to 2,360 kg. The difference is around 1,172 kg.

Looking at boot space, the SEAT Arona offers only slightly more boot space – 400 L compared to 367 L. That’s a difference of about 33 L.

When it comes to payload, the SEAT Arona carries markedly more – 522 kg compared to 375 kg. That’s a difference of about 147 kg.

SEAT Arona

The SEAT Arona is a cheeky urban crossover that mixes sharp styling with sensible practicality, making it an appealing choice for buyers who want personality without fuss. It’s zippy in traffic, comfortable enough for daily driving, and brings enough character to make routine journeys feel a little more fun.

details

SERES 5

The Seres 5 carves a convincing niche in the crowded compact crossover market with bold styling and a surprisingly upscale cabin that feels larger than its footprint suggests. It’s an easy, fuss-free choice for shoppers after modern EV practicality and sensible running costs, delivered with a friendly personality that won’t try to outshine more expensive rivals.
